Glossary

Plain-language definitions for the concepts that shape federated compute, government environments, AI, trust, and operations.

Federation

A coordinated service across independently controlled resources under shared technical, commercial, governance, and evidence rules.

Control plane

The layer that discovers, qualifies, schedules, governs, meters, and operates resources and workloads.

Capacitas Sovereign Node

A node where Capacitas controls the site or facility and hardware through ownership or equivalent durable rights.

Federated Secure Node

A partner-controlled site where Capacitas has a defined secure boundary and durable operating rights.

Partner Cloud Node

Third-party cloud or colocation capacity used under explicit technical and contractual controls.

Workload eligibility

The decision that a specific customer, workload, data set, model, and configuration may use a specific service and environment.

Data sovereignty

The legal, contractual, jurisdictional, and operational control requirements governing data and derived artifacts.

DDIL

Denied, disrupted, intermittent, or limited connectivity conditions that change permitted local and synchronized behavior.

Operating receipt

A record connecting authorization, executing site, resource, usage, price, energy method, service outcome, and settlement.

Evidence record

A dated, scoped record supporting a claim, decision, configuration, test, assessment, authorization, incident, or outcome.

Shared responsibility

The explicit allocation of duties across Capacitas, node operators, providers, partners, and customers.

Qualified capacity

Resources whose ownership, configuration, operating state, constraints, rights, and evidence satisfy the defined requirement.
